Pan-fried Cooking
3 oz Beef Top Sirloin is typically cooked Pan-fried, which allows for a crispy exterior and tender interior. When cooking, it's important to use high heat and a good-quality pan to ensure even cooking and a perfect sear. To cook 3 oz beef top sirloin, simply heat a pan over high heat and add oil. Once the oil is hot, add the beef and cook for approximately 3-4 minutes per side, or until the internal temperature reaches 145°F. Let the beef rest for a few minutes before slicing and serving.

Iron-rich Diet
3 oz Beef Top Sirloin is an excellent source of iron, a mineral that's essential for healthy red blood cells and oxygen transport. For those with iron-deficiency anemia, incorporating Iron-rich foods like 3 oz beef top sirloin into their diet can help improve energy levels and overall health. To enhance the iron content of your meal, consider pairing 3 oz beef top sirloin with other iron-rich foods like spinach, quinoa, or lentils.
